Fuel TV Australia signs streaming deal with the Seven Network

Fuel TV

Fuel TV Australia and the Seven Network have signed an agreement that will see a 24/7 streaming channel running on the 7plus platform, as well as dedicated block programming on 7mate.

Fuel TV is an Emmy Award-winning global channel with programming focusing on the culture and lifestyle of skateboarding, snowboarding, surfing, BMX, MTB, motocross and wakeboarding.

As an independent business, Fuel TV is seen in more than 103 countries, broadcast in five languages to more than 770 million homes. The channel was born in the US, being founded by Fox Sports Media Group reaching 40 million homes in the US by 2013.

Fuel TV Australian managing partner Jay Palmer said: “We are proud to be aligned with such a progressive network as Seven. We look forward to adding to their action sports credentials and showcasing the sports and culture we love as we head towards a pivotal time in action sports with the inclusion of surfing and skateboarding in the Tokyo 2020 Olympic Games.”
